How do I move my itunes library from my hard drive to an external hardrive?

I am trying to free up storage space on my imac hard drive. I have one external hard drive with 500 GB storga and then another 2 TB external hard drive that I am using as my time machine back up of everything. I moved my itunes library (approx. 70GB) over to the 500 GB hard drive, but I think it is still somewhere on the imac HD. I am looking for simple directions on how to move my itunes library and/or iphoto library and deleting the oriiginal version on my HD so that I have adequate room on my startup disk. Thoughts?

Drag the libraries there, launch each application with the Option key held down and point them to the libraries on the external drive. The iPhoto library must be stored on a drive, partition, or disk image formatted as Mac OS Extended (Journaled).


Once done, they can be deleted from the internal drive but should be kept on a second drive.
